A Comprehensive Study on Cotton Rubber Conveyor Belts: Structure, Selection, and Factory Sourcing Efficiency

1. Executive Summary & Market Mechanics

Within the global bulk material handling landscape, Cotton Rubber Conveyor Belts (commonly known as CC Conveyor Belts) serve as a foundational technology for medium and short-distance transit operations. Utilized extensively in industries requiring low thermal expansion, moderate tensile limits, and budget-optimized engineering, these belts utilize a carcass constructed from pure cotton (CC-56 type) or cotton-polyester blends. This organic framework offers unique dynamic elasticity, superior tracking behavior, and resistance to standard industrial shear stresses.

As bulk logistics networks demand longer continuous cycles and reduced operational downtime, understanding the physical chemistry of the elastomer cover compound and the weaving density of the cotton carcass is paramount. 2. Comparative Material Analysis: Cotton vs. Synthetic Plies

When selecting a carcass structure, procurement teams must analyze mechanical load characteristics, temperature exposure, and environmental humidity. While synthetic plies such as Polyester (EP) and Nylon (NN) provide higher ultimate tensile strength, cotton fabrics possess properties that make them ideal for specialized industrial processes.

Cotton Carcass (CC)

Characterized by minimum mechanical elongation under high tension, preventing belt stretch issues on short-to-medium centers. Offers natural surface adhesion properties with standard rubber skim coats, preventing ply separation under high flex fatigue.

Polyester Carcass (EP)

Engineered for high dimensional stability and superior impact resistance. Exhibits strong chemical resistance to damp environments, making it suitable for wet aggregates, slurry handling, and long overland conveying systems.

Nylon Carcass (NN)

Offers elastic recovery properties, allowing the belt to absorb heavy, repeated impact from large material drops. Provides high flexibility over pulleys, suitable for high-speed, long-distance mineral transport operations.

The adhesion between the cotton fabric layers and the rubber covers is critical. We use customized calendering processes to guarantee a ply-to-ply adhesion strength of ≥ 3.2 N/mm. This prevents delamination in harsh operating conditions, such as high-vibration screening circuits and agricultural grain handling systems.

1. Localized Application Engineering

Cotton rubber conveyor belts excel in environments requiring low electrostatic build-up and high carcass flexibility. Our "Jinao" brand CC belts are tailored for:

  • Agricultural Terminals: Grain handling facilities utilize cotton belts because they limit static electricity build-up, reducing the risk of dust explosions.
  • Cement Batching & Lime Plants: The dry heat absorption profiles of cotton plies outperform standard polyester under low thermal stress (up to 100°C).
  • Coal Processing: Selected cotton conveyor systems are configured for underground transits where moderate impact resilience is required.

Q1: What are the main differences between Cotton (CC) and Polyester (EP) conveyor belts?
A: Cotton (CC) conveyor belts provide minimal permanent structural stretch over short center distances, low electrostatic charging properties, and good elasticity for high-flex cycles. Polyester (EP) belts offer higher ultimate tensile strength, better resilience to moisture, and superior resistance to microbiological attack, making them preferable for long-distance, high-tension outdoor transport systems.
Q2: How does Hebei Boao verify ply adhesion in cotton rubber conveyor belts?
A: We test ply-to-ply adhesion in our laboratory using peeling testers. We confirm that our CC belts meet or exceed the GB/T 7984-2013 standard of ≥ 3.2 N/mm. This high adhesion standard prevents separation between the rubber covers and the inner cotton core during high-flex cycles.
Q3: What cover rubber grades are available for cotton canvas conveyor belts?
A: We supply cover rubber grades to fit specific operational conditions. This includes Grade L for general transport, Grade D for high abrasion resistance, and Grade H for heavy-impact environments. Our formulations match DIN 22102 and ISO 14890 standards.
Q4: Why are cotton rubber conveyor belts preferred for bulk grain handling?
A: The organic cotton core does not generate high static charges, which reduces static electricity build-up in grain processing silos and agricultural terminals. This performance characteristic lowers the risk of dust ignition events, improving overall plant safety.
